Journalist Jeremiah Mphande who was accused of defiling a niece acquitted

Senior Resident Magistrate Abdulrahaman Maulidi sitting in Mzimba from Mzuzu has acquitted Mzimba based Ministry of Information journalist Jeremiah Mphande, 42, who was answering a defilement charge.

Delivering the ruling, Maulidi said there was no evidence to show that Mphande had defiled his wife’s niece, 15.

The Magistrate added that, on 24th January 2021, the wife of the suspect( Mirriam Banda) only found her husband and the victim in the same room and there was no clear evidence to prove that the two had sexual intercourse.

He has quashed aside a medical report from Mzimba District Hospital saying it lacked merit as it did not show clearly that sexual penetration occurred.

Lawyer for Mphande, Gilbert Khonyongwa says they expected the ruling as evidence brought before court was clear about his client’s innocence.

State Prosecutor Isaac Imedi says the ‘shocking ruling’ is due to the witnesses ( wife and the victim) turning hostile in court by contradicting their initial statements.
